Veterans Find Meineke Ownership a Great Second Career

Training and Skills Developed in Military Service Help Fuel Success for Franchise Owners

June 03, 2019 // Franchising.com // CHARLOTTE - While Nate and Josh Ramsay were serving their country in Iraq, their older brother Ben was building the foundation for a business that they could both work in when they returned home.

“I had the automotive experience of managing a Meineke store in Harrisburg, PA for someone else,” said Ben Ramsay. “When the opportunity came up to purchase a franchise in York, PA in 2012, my brothers and I sold everything we had to finance the purchase. We were partners from the beginning. The plan was that I would get things started, and Nate and Josh would join me once their deployment was over.”

Nate Ramsay knew nothing about cars when he finished his three tours of duty as a Staff Sargent in the U.S. Army 82nd Airborne Division, serving from 2006 to 2013. Neither did Josh, also an active duty Staff Sargent in the U.S. Army National Guard serving until late 2013.

“I enlisted in 2002 while in high school,” said Josh Ramsay. “On Friday I graduated high school, and the next Monday I was in boot camp.”

The skills they learned in the service had nothing to do with vehicles, but it did help prepare them for success in business. Josh Ramsay was involved in aviation life support and Nate Ramsay was a forward observer during their duty in Iraq.

“Military service breeds a good work ethic,” said Nate Ramsay. “The military is a standards-driven organization, and setting standards in your business is critical to success. None of us went to college, but military service helps you develop people skills necessary for successfully dealing with both employees and customers.”

“It also gave us the attitude to just put our heads down and drive forward,” said Josh Ramsay.

And that is what the three Ramsay brothers did.

Between older brother Ben’s experience managing a Meineke store, the support they received from the Meineke Operations team, and the sharing among the network of other Meineke operators, they have grown to five centers in just six years.

“Sales our first year in business exceeded our expectations,” said Ben Ramsay. “It was head down, six days a week that first year. When my brothers returned in 2013, we began a rapid expansion. Two more stores in 2014, one in 2015, and the fifth in 2018. And we are looking to grow more.”

“Meineke has greatly evolved in the last five to six years,” said Nate Ramsay. “We have confidence that with the current leadership it is moving in the right direction to keep us at the cutting edge of operational excellence and customer satisfaction. Meineke has a strong playbook and their operations people are incredible at supporting multiple location owners.”

With five stores and three brothers, they each have had to make the transition from owner/operator to owner.

“It forces you work on your business instead of in your business,” said Ben Ramsay. “And it requires that you hire good employees.”

Nate Ramsay said that hiring veterans is a priority for them.

“We advertise for veterans because veterans are your best employees,” Nate Ramsay said. “We love to hire veterans and we have had good success in that area.”

Every Veterans Day they offer free oil changes for veterans, a practice many other Meineke locations have adopted.

“Veterans are one big family, and we take care of each other. We shut down all other operations on that day and perform only oil changes,“ said Nate Ramsay. “Veterans are extremely appreciative and loyal people. We do it to give back, but it also can create a new and loyal customer.”

The Ramsay brothers have found a formula for success, as evidenced by their recognition at the Meineke convention earlier this year, winning the Commitment to Excellence award, an award which is presented to the franchisee that represents and supports the brand above self. About Meineke

Meineke Car Care Centers, Inc., is a division of Driven Brands, Inc., the leading automotive aftermarket franchisor in the world. Founded in 1972, Meineke has more than 800 centers that service approximately 3 million cars a year. Meineke continues to be ranked as one of the best franchise opportunities in the country.

About Driven Brands

Driven Brands, headquartered in Charlotte, NC, is the parent company of North America’s leading automotive aftermarket brands across four distinct verticals: Repair & Maintenance, housing Meineke Car Care Centers®; Paint & Collision, housing Maaco® and CARSTAR North America®; Distribution, housing 1-800-Radiator & A/C®; and Quick Lube, housing Take 5 Oil Change. Driven Brands has more than 2,500 centers across North America, and combined, all businesses generate more than $2.6 billion in system sales and service approximately 8 million vehicles annually.
